










He was born and raised in Hueytown, Alabama, a small suburb
outside of Birmingham.
As a child his life was filled with music. He grew up listening to
legends such as
Dean Martin, Frank Sinatra, Tony Bennett, and of course Elvis.
His love for music grew and so did his desire to perform.
In August of 2000, his dreams became a reality when he
auditioned and was chosen
to perform on Dick Clark's "Your Big Break", a musical talent
show hosted by NBC.
His first performance was aired before a national television
audience.
Since that time, opportunities have continued to present
themselves.
He has performed in many venues across the United States and
Canada
. On October 12th 2001, he produced, directed and performed in
his first full
production "If I Can Dream", a musical tribute to Elvis. He has
also appeared on the
Ricki Lake show, performed at the Rialto Theatre in "An
American Trilogy" and
been featured in Karaoke Singers Magazine. His first CD was
released last year entitled "In My
Way"
. He is a versatile performer with the ability to depict each era of
Elvis' life. From
the early Gold Lame and fun songs of the movie years to the raw
black
leather of the '68 Comeback and the legendary Vegas years, He
maintains a
performance of incredible authenticity.
